Sorry to hear about your headaches.
I have both migraines and stress headaches.
The mirgraines can be helped with the Imagrin if you catch them early. I still feel "Spaced" but without the pain.
The stress headaches just go up the neck and across brow and behind eyes. I use anti inlfams. for a few days to help.
Can you check if you are holding tension in your upper back, shoulder and neck muscles.
You would really need someone to pick this up as the muscles go into spasm. I have a aromotherapist friend who describes my shoulders as like steel.
A physio taught me a technique to help release them but someone has to help you.
Ask the yoga teacher to show you some postures e.g. head of a cow, shoulder rolling?Maybe visit to GP ?
